Find
Near

Solar Energy Equipment & Systems Service & Repair Near Me

Solar Connector
19925 Stevens Creek Blvd Cupertino CA 95014
Phone: 4088775520
ML Solar, Inc
1190 Dell Ave Suite O Ste O Campbell CA 95008
Phone: 4085838101
Staples
20830 Stevens Creek Blvd Cupertino CA 95014
Phone: 4082521019
Apolo Energy
19925 Stevens Creek Blvd Cupertino CA 95014
Phone: 4087257539
Judkins.net
10306 Bret Ave Cupertino CA 95014
Phone: 4089961479
Solar Land Partner
12672 Kane Dr SARATOGA CA 95070
Phone: 4088132683
B Eohana Solar
19925 Stevens Creek Blvd Cupertino CA 95014
Phone: 4087257107
Sunpower Corporation
Serving Your Area Santa Clara CA 95051
Phone: 8007867693
Highlight Solar
1202 Kifer Rd Sunnyvale CA 94086
Phone: 8669269997